What are impacts to the cardiovascular system from high altitude?
alex41 [277]
Acute exposure to high altitude can affect the cardiovascular system by decreasing oxygen in the blood (acute hypoxia). It also increases demand on the heart, adrenaline release and pulmonary artery pressures.

To ensure safety, leftovers that have been properly wrapped and refrigerated should be eaten within:______.
harina [27]

To ensure safety, leftovers that have been properly wrapped and refrigerated should be eaten within<u> three days.</u>

Leftovers can be kept for three to four days in the refrigerator. We should be sure to eat them within that time. After that, the risk of food poisoning increases. Food poisoning is the result of eating contaminated, spoiled, or toxic food. hence, to avoid such condition food must be consumed within shortest duration possible.
